Overview
- Puma CEO Arne Freundt will leave the company by the end of next week after disagreements over strategy implementation.
- Arthur Hoeld, a former Adidas executive and previous candidate for Adidas's CEO role, will assume Puma's top position starting July 1, 2025.
- The leadership shift follows Puma's ongoing financial struggles, including a 7.6% profit decline in 2024 and projected weaker results for 2025.
- Matthias Bäumer has been retroactively appointed as Chief Commercial Officer, effective April 1, 2025, as part of broader organizational restructuring.
- This leadership transition underscores the competitive rivalry between Puma and Adidas, with both companies headquartered in Herzogenaurach.
